Local Area
Janska is located 10km from Prague and only 2km east of Beroun in a small town called Lodenice. It is only a short walk from the local amenities such as local shops, school, railway / bus stations and several factories.
Beroun is the closest city and is located 20km south west of Prague city centre. The drive from Prague to Beroun is only 20-25 minutes along the D5 highway which continues to Pilzen and Germany. There is also a train that runs from Beroun to Prague and takes approx. 35-40 minutes.
Beroun is one of the fastest growing regions in the Czech Republic with property prices already growing at an alarming rate. There has been a lot of foreign direct investment in to Prague and Beroun also with companies such as Lidl, Hypernova, Skoda, Kia Motors, Best Western Hotels, Kaufland, Delvita, Billa, Ceskomoravsky Cement, Kostal, Tipsport, Linde Frigera, Hornschuh, with a presence in Beroun and also Ikea which is close by but not in the city. The development itself is located in the centre of the town walking distance from shops, bars, cafes, restaurants, the river Berounka and the main town square where a market is held. Other local amenities include schools, swimming pool/leisure centre, cinema and walking routes as well as tourist attractions such as the Karlstejn castle and golf course.
